1. Delta Dental PPO plus Premier

The Delta Dental PPO plus Premier dental plan is the combination of Delta’s PPO and its Premier program. The Premier program is a contracted national network of dentists who agree to provide services at negotiated fees. This is currently the country’s largest dental network. This, combined with Delta’s extensive PPO network, translates to even more dentists to serve you and give you discounted rates.

Under this combination plan, you can go to any PPO or Premier dentist and enjoy the same amazing discounts.

2. AARP Dental Insurance

Delta also offers a dental insurance plan exclusively for members of the AARP or American Association of Retired Persons. The organization consists of Americans over the age of 50. Members of the association are offered their choice between 2 PPO plans. Both plans entitle them to three free cleanings per year. They also have a wide selection of dentists to choose from.

3. Delta Select or TRICARE Retiree Dental Program

Delta is also the hand behind the TRICARE Retiree Dental Program, sometimes known as Delta Select. This is the company’s way of recognizing the valuable contribution of these retirees to the country. By offering them the access to affordable dental care both for them and their families, Delta helps them stay healthy and save more.

This program offers the same extensive PPO network to retirees of the Uniformed Services as well as their families. The plan has very low premiums so the retirees can easily afford it. It also requires very low deductibles but has high annual maximums so retirees and their families can get as many benefits as they can from the plan.

4. Costco Group Dental Plans

Delta Dental also offers dental plans for individuals and families who are members of the Costco Executive Members in California. The Costco Group plans are prepaid plans with low annual fees that members can easily afford. There is no waiting period so the members can immediately enjoy the benefits. Deductibles and maximums are also done away with. The members can choose dentists from the DeltaCare USA network. Members, however, are required to choose one primary dentist who will take care of most of their dental care needs and refer them to a specialist when necessary.

The Differences among Delta Dental’s Plans - Delta Dental Provider Themselves

The Delta Dental PPO and HMO plans are high-quality dental plans that offer comprehensive coverage, great savings, and a lot of dentists. The PPO plans or Preferred Provider Organization plans allow members to choose from PPO dentists, who have agreed to accept reduced fees as full payment for the services they render. When members choose a dentist within the PPO network, they can enjoy the discounts in full. When they choose from outside the network, they enjoy smaller discounts.

Delta’s HMO plans, on the other hand, are prepaid plans wherein you don’t pay deductibles nor will you be limited to annual maximums. When you seek dental care, you will be required to pay a fixed amount for it; this will be called your copayment. Some procedures, such as diagnostic and preventive ones, don’t require copayments. However, you get no discounts if you go to a dentist not part of the HMO network.

Delta also offers fee-for-service plans, which are also known as traditional plans and indemnity plans. Delta’s fee-for-service plans are known for its great selection of dentists. These plans work a bit like PPO plans. If you choose a dentist from the network, you will pay a certain portion of the fees for the service; this portion is called the coinsurance. The rest will then be shouldered by the plan. The coinsurance differs for each service. For example, you only have to pay a 20% coinsurance for preventive services but 50% for crowns and bridges.
